Street Hearts BG all set to become registered United Kingdom’s Charity
The Bulgaria-based non-profit Organisation Street Hearts BG has provided support and services to their dogs living in the United Kingdom through lifetime support and rescue backup. They are also one step away from becoming a registered UK Charity under the Street Hearts Charitable Trust.
UK: ‘Save the Children’ saves Ukrainian child Polina, funds her education
The UK-based non-profit organisation 'Save the Children' saved a Ukrainian child Polina who now attends school in the UK but is struggling to learn and make friends due to the language barrier. The NPO is funding her education following the Russia-Ukraine war, which broke out in February 2022.
